「Ask Ubuntu」にこの質問を投稿しましたが、答えはありません。
Ubuntu LTS 16.04にApache2をインストールしました。 /home/ubuntu/.viminfo ファイルを確認しましたが、次の行が含まれています。
# Registers:
"0 LINE 0
ProxyPass /app/ http://10.0.1.7/
"1 LINE 0
ProxyPass /app1/ http://10.0.1.27/
"2 LINE 0
ProxyPass /app1/ http://10.0.1.27/
"3 LINE 0
ProxyPass /app1/ http://10.0.1.27/
""- CHAR 0
2
10.0.1.27項目を10.0.1.7に変更しましたが、実行中です。
sudo /etc/init.d/apache2 restart
もう一度10.0.1.27に変更してください。 (私はもはやプライベートIP 10.0.1.27を使用しているサーバーを所有していません。)
明らかにいくつかの設定ファイル設定があります
ProxyPass /app1/ http://10.0.1.27/
いつ
sudo /etc/init.d/apache2 restart
呼び出されたが、/etc/apache2/apache2.confまたは/etc/apache2/httpd.confから、または呼び出して何も見つかりません。
sudo grep app1 /etc/apache2/*.*
ベストアンサー1
~/.viminfo
ユーザーファイル(この場合)には、実行間でエディタの状態を維持するubuntu
ために使用されるさまざまな情報が含まれています。スタックは、オブジェクトを保存するために使用される番号名1から9までのレジスタで構成されています。 vimがあればvimについて教えてくれます。vim
vi
vim
registers
:help quote_number
結論は、vimを使用してこのファイルを編集してから終了すると、現在のレジスタスタックを使用してファイルが再生成されることです。
これはほとんど間違いなくそれとは何の関係もありませんsudo apache restart
。